Crashline ingests crash reports from the Fernbright mobile apps and is normally managed through the Opaline deployment service. If Opaline is unavailable and crash ingestion stalls beyond thirty minutes, break-glass is permitted, but only after paging the pipeline owner and recording the incident number. The procedure grants a temporary admin role scoped to the ingestion queue, expiring after two hours. Access is gained through the sealed console, which first asks for the recovery passphrase given below.

strongbox words: caswyn-druwyn

Checklist item 4: Pool-car key cabinet. Visiting contractors working on the Brindlemoor site may use Ostrane pool vehicles when authorised by your site supervisor. The key cabinet is located in the facilities corridor behind the ground-floor lift lobby. Collect only the key tagged with your booking reference, record the mileage before departure, and return the key within the same shift. Fuel cards stay in the glovebox. The cabinet is electronically locked and will only release keys after you enter the code below.

door code, kawip-bagap: bdg-HQEWH-4

Ticket: sign-off requested for the Inkwheel spooler microservice. Changes include a bounded retry queue, per-tenant job caps, and graceful drain on shutdown. Load tests on the Fernhall cluster showed no regressions at twice peak volume. Remaining risk is the legacy driver shim, documented in the appendix. Before we schedule rollout, we need written approval from the accountable engineer named below.

account owner for fajep-yagef: Kasix Eliiel